West Footscray - Tottenham · Statistical Area 2 (SA2)
Work across the area — who is in the labour force, in which industries and jobs.
Over 32% of workers in West Footscray - Tottenham are professionals, making it a highly skilled area. The local workforce is very active, with 69.8% of adults working or looking for work, which is well above the national figure of 61.1%.
Employment, participation and unemployment.
Full-time employment is much higher here than in most areas, at 62.0%. While the unemployment rate has fallen to 5.6% since 2011, it remains higher than in most similar areas.

The industries that employ local workers.
The local economy is led by health care and social assistance, where 13.1% of people work. Other major sectors include education and training at 10.5% and professional and technical services at 10.4%.
The kinds of jobs people do.
Beyond professionals, managers make up 14.9% of the local workforce. Clerical and administrative roles are also common at 12.5%, followed by technicians and trades at 9.9%.
